So, technically Republicans are wrong if they say Budget Reconciliation was used to pass Obamacare, although it was … budds farm wastewater treatment worksWeb19 de jul. de 2024 · Obamacare was passed by the House of Representatives on November 7, 2009, with a vote of 220-215. The Senate passed an amended version of the bill on December 24, 2009, with a vote of 60-39.
